This exceptional Waycross commercial property at 308 Mary Street offers a compelling investment opportunity. The 24,500 square foot building currently houses two established tenants, The Crest Cafe and Wiley's Top Shelf, generating a substantial monthly rental income of $6,000. This income stream is complemented by an additional 12,000 square feet of readily available space upstairs, presenting significant potential for future lease agreements and increased revenue. The property sits on a 0.31-acre lot and boasts convenient access via three street entrances on Mary Street, Lott Street, and Alice Street. A spacious courtyard adds to the property's appeal and functionality.
